Tools and Resources for Players
Many gambling platforms now offer a range of tools and resources designed to support responsible gaming. These features typically include deposit limits, loss limits, and cool-off periods that allow players to take a break from gambling activities. Such tools empower individuals to manage their gaming habits more effectively and prevent overindulgence.
In addition to built-in features, various organizations provide education and support for those struggling with gambling-related issues. Resources like helplines and support groups play a crucial role in guiding players towards healthier choices and offering assistance when needed. By highlighting these resources, the gambling industry demonstrates its commitment to responsible gaming.

The Role of Technology in Responsible Gaming
Technology plays a significant role in advancing responsible gaming initiatives. With the rise of artificial intelligence and data analytics, gambling operators can better monitor player behavior and identify potential signs of problematic gambling. This proactive approach enables operators to intervene when necessary, offering support and resources to at-risk individuals.
Furthermore, advancements in technology allow for personalized gaming experiences that can help players make informed decisions. Features such as in-game reminders, personalized risk assessments, and tailored recommendations can empower players to gamble responsibly, enhancing their overall gaming experience while minimizing potential risks.
